The dosage is based on your medical condition and response to ... WebAug 2, 2024 · As with amiodarone, taking citalopram and fluconazole together can raise the risk of heart rhythm problems. This risk is higher for people who have preexisting heart problems. If you’re taking both citalopram and fluconazole together, citalopram’s labeling recommends limiting the dose to 20 mg once daily while taking fluconazole.

WebPatients should be cautioned about the risk of serotonin syndrome with the concomitant use of citalopram and triptans, tramadol or other serotonergic agents. Patients should be advised that taking citalopram can cause mild pupillary dilation, which in susceptible individuals, can lead to an episode of angle closure glaucoma.
